Picture the result in your actual room
The biggest value is clarity. Instead of guessing from mood boards or store photos, you can see how a darker wall color, warmer wood tones, or a calmer layout could look in the bedroom you already have.
Compare styles before you buy anything
A bedroom redesign often stalls when two ideas both sound right. Seeing several directions on the same bed, windows, and floor plan makes it easier to choose between minimal, cozy, hotel-like, or more layered looks with confidence.
Plan changes that fit real budgets
Good bedroom planning is not only about taste. It helps you spot what needs a full replacement, what can be refinished, and what only needs paint, lighting, bedding, or storage, which keeps decisions more practical and less wasteful.

Preserve the layout
The design should respect the room structure that already exists, including the bed wall, door swing, window wall, and walking paths. That matters in a bedroom, where a virtual bedroom makeover only helps if the nightstands, dresser clearance, and circulation still make sense.
Control color and finish changes
Good bedroom design tools should let you test paint direction, wood tone, bedding mood, and accent contrast without changing the whole concept at once. If color is your main decision, a paint color visualizer is the better next step for comparing wall shades with more focus.
Generate comparable style variations
Strong feature design means creating multiple versions from the same photo so you can compare minimal, cozy, modern, or hotel-inspired looks on one bedroom. The useful part is consistency: the angle, proportions, and major pieces stay stable enough to compare changes instead of guessing from unrelated inspiration images.
Connect ideas to practical planning
A redesign is more helpful when you can move from concept to room decisions such as furniture spacing, storage, and closet flow. After you choose a direction, a room planner can help you test fit and placement before you buy larger pieces or rearrange the bedroom.
